Vasa Museum (Vasamuseet)
- Location: Djurgården, a popular island in central Stockholm.
- Highlights: The Vasa Museum houses the world-famous 17th-century warship, Vasa, which sank on its maiden voyage in 1628 and was salvaged and restored in the late 20th century.
- Recommendation: Plan to spend a few hours here to fully appreciate this incredible historical artifact.
Drottningholm Palace (Drottningholms slott)
- Location: Drottningholm, an island in southern Stockholm.
- Highlights: The private residence of the Swedish Royal Family is the oldest palace still used by a monarchy in Europe and offers beautiful gardens, the Chinese Pavilion, and the renowned theater.
- Tip: Take a guided tour to learn about the history, art, and architecture of this magnificent complex.
Skansen Open-Air Museum (Skansen)
- Location: Djurgården island.
- Highlights: As the world’s first open-air museum, Skansen showcases traditional Swedish buildings, crafts, and rural life from the 16th century to the present day. Don’t miss the Sami camp, the aquarium, or the zoo.
- Suggestion: Visit during midsummer (June 20-24) for a traditional Swedish celebration with folk dancing, music, and food.
Archipelago of Stockholm (Stockholms skärgård)
- Location: Just off the coast of central Stockholm.
- Highlights: With thousands of islands, this archipelago offers pristine nature, picturesque villages, and stunning vistas.
- Recommendation: Embark on a boat tour or rent kayaks for a unique experience exploring the islands at your own pace.
Royal Palace (Kungliga Slottet)
- Location: Gamla Stan (the Old Town).
- Highlights: The largest palace in Scandinavia, housing the offices of His Majesty the King and the Swedish government. The changing of the guard ceremony takes place daily at 12:15 PM.
- Tip: Take a guided tour to explore the magnificent state apartments, museums, and gardens.
